Relationship between CH4 and N2O flux from soil and their ambient mixing ratio in a riparian rice-based agroecosystem of tropical region
Abstract
Temporal variations of the ambient mixing ratio of greenhouse gas (CH4 and N2O) in a riparian rice-based agro-ecosystem of tropical region were studied during 2005–2006 in coastal Odisha. The endeavour was made with the hypothesis that the ambient mixing ratio of CH4 and N2O depends on the changes in the flux of CH4 and N2O from the rice fields in the riparian rice ecosystems.
